Zhonghe Festival 2024 (China): The Zhonghe Festival, which has been observed in China for numerous centuries, will occur on March 11 this year. The event in question is inaugurated on the initial day of the second lunar month in China. This implies that, depending on the year and the Gregorian calendar, it occurs in February or March. The festival, alternatively referred to as the Blue Dragon Festival, originated during the Tang and Song Dynasties, two Chinese monarchies that ruled in the Middle Ages. It is a traditional celebration honoring the end of winter and the onset of spring, as well as a time when agriculture reawakens.

Zhonghe Festival History

The Zhonghe Festival, alternatively referred to as the Longtaitou Festival or the Blue Dragon Festival, is an antiquated agricultural celebration in China. “The dragon raising its head” is the meaning of Longtaitou, alluding to the beast that is believed to have dominion over all living things and, more significantly, to control the rains.

The origins of the Zhonghe Festival can be traced back to the reigns of the Tang and Song dynasties. It is believed that the Dragon King, also known as the “Dragon God,” is the deity associated with the weather and aquatic elements. He is capable of manifesting himself in an extensive variety of ways. The Blue Dragon symbolizes the essence of spring; he is the deity of the East. The festival observes the ceremonial veneration of the Dragon King, a deity linked to the occurrence of spring precipitation. Farmers observe the Zhonghe Festival in anticipation of favorable harvest season weather and tillage conditions.

At present, devotion continues to be directed towards ‘Tudigong,’ the deity associated with the ground and soil. Throughout Chinese popular religions and Taoism, adherents have held this minor deity in high regard. The festival coincides with the third solar period of the Chinese calendar, known as “Jingzhe.” This phenomenon is known as the “awakening of insects” and occurs when the first warm indications of spring rouse the land and its hibernating animals.

A considerable number of major cities in China, nevertheless, fail to observe the Zhonghe Festival; in fact, specific hamlets and villages may not even observe it. There are numerous traditions observed in the locations where it is observed. The Dragon God, to begin with, is revered. To ensure a bountiful harvest, attendees of this festival pray that the Dragon King or a deity will bestow sufficient precipitation.
